Heres an investment!

Number 505 Conrod Straight, Bathurst is up for sale, offering motorsports fans a piece of the sacred mountain that goes by the name Panorama.

Yep, for a lazy $2 million you can buy the best seats in the house at the Bathurst 1000 for the next half century, with an uninterrupted view of the fastest slice of blacktop in Australia – the crest of Conrod Straight and into The Chase.

It’s no news that The Mountain is a public road for all but four weekends of the year, making Conrod a part of your daily commute and the Bathurst circuit a relative bitumen moat around your very own castle. It’s the vibe of the thing..

and in related news -
This is the last year with Supercheap as naming rights sponsor, It'll be Repco from 2021- https://au.motorsport.com/v8supercars/news/repco-supercheap-bathurst-1000-sponsor/4859131/
Camaro's to join the field from 2022, with some design rules to be changed for the Gen3 cars in 2022.
Quote
Gen3 will require that all race cars have the same dimensions as the road cars they are based on for all key body components, such as doors, roof, windows and bonnet.
Such components must be interchangeable with that on the respective road car, marking a return to the category’s heritage.

As well as a reduction in aero, and less access to data..... an attempt to put it more back on the skill of the driver.
